a new way to look at burnout

5/26/2026

0 Comments

 
Today’s tip is this:

Working less is not necessarily the cure or prevention for burnout.

That might seem like a strange or even harsh statement, but there’s a quote from Patrick Lencioni in his book The 6 Types of Working Genius that explains why this is:

“…the type of work that a person does turns out to be much more important in regard to burnout than the volume of work. Some people can work long hours over extended periods of time in their areas of joy and passion, while others can work relatively few hours but experience severe burnout because they are doing work that robs they of joy and passion. It follows logically then that a person who is experiencing the first signs of burnout will not find relief simply by reducing the time they spend at work, even though that is often what we prescribe for them. What they need to do is spend more time doing what feeds them.”

So if you seem to have lost your joy and passion in what you do or are experiencing signs of burnout, take some time to think through the things that you are doing and what drains you versus what energizes you. Find ways, at work or outside of work, to spend more time doing the things that energize you.

How did God Shape and Gift you?

5/5/2026

0 Comments

 
Today’s Tip is this:

Take time to figure out how God has created and shaped you.

The more we understand who God has created and designed us to be, the more we will be able to show love and grace toward ourselves and others. When we don’t understand how we are wired and gifted we can struggle with the expectations we have for ourselves or that we feel that others place on us. As we understand more of who God created us to be, we feel less guilt for the areas that are not our strengths and appreciate those people whose strengths and gifts complement our weaknesses. We can also give that same understanding to others because we understand that God has created and gifted us all in different ways.

There are lots of ways that you can figure out how God has created and shaped you. Always start and end with prayer and surround any other tools that you use with prayer as well asking God to give you wisdom and insight. Consider a personality assessment like Myers-Briggs or DISC or the many others out there if you’ve never done that. Look into what the Bible says about spiritual gifts and consider a study on that like SHAPE, PLACE or many others. There are many other tools out there that will give you insights into specifics about how you were created and wired including the Working Genius model and many more. Take some time to learn more about how God has wired you.
